    Linda followed "Simple Dreams" which mixed, pop, rock, and country perfectly with this set, which increased the stylistic mix to include Elvis Costello (and Presley), plus her first attempt at a standard. Linda's voice holds this album together, but there are a couple of weak spots. Linda doesn't sound comfortable with "When I Grow Too Old To Dream", and I personally don't care for her cover of "Mohammed's Radio". I love the rest, especially "White Rhythm and Blues", "Alison", and "Ooh Baby Baby". This is Linda at the height of her '70s reign as the queen of rock.
